SUMMARY:Alzheimer Caregiver Support Group
DESCRIPTION:Support Changes Everything \nThis support group is for those caring for someone living with dementia. Understanding dementia and its progression is vital to ensure that both you and the person you’re caring for can live as well as possible. \nOur caregiver group involves support for you and the care being provided to the person living with Alzheimer’s or Dementia through sharing feelings and experiences\, the ability to discuss different coping strategies\, and participate in conversation and learning. \nOur Support Group will be held in person the  1st Wednesday of Every Month and the 3rd Monday of every Month (if it is a Holiday Monday this group will be the 4th Monday). No registration needed\, everyone is welcome! \nSuite 202\, 5101 48th Street (2nd Floor of the Sprucewood Centre) \nFor more information\, please contact the Primary Care Network at 780-874-0490. \n  \n \nIf you would like more information about dementia\, caregiving\, diagnosis\, and/or our programs and services\, please call our Dementia Helpline at 1-877-949-4141 or visit https://alzheimer.ca/sk/en
